Asphalt roof inspection services involve a detailed assessment of the roofing system to identify potential issues before they develop into major problems. Trained inspectors examine the surface for signs of damage, such as cracks, blisters, or areas where the asphalt may be deteriorating. They also evaluate the condition of flashing, vents, and other roof penetrations to ensure all components are secure and functioning properly. This process helps property owners understand the current state of their roof and determine if repairs or maintenance are necessary to prolong its lifespan.

These inspections are crucial for addressing common roofing problems like leaks, water damage, and structural weaknesses.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ause asphalt shingles to weaken, leading to cracks or missing shingles that compromise the roof’s integrity. Detecting issues early through regular inspections can prevent costly repairs and extensive damage to the underlying structure or interior spaces. Additionally, inspections can identify areas prone to water infiltration, mold growth, or other issues that may not be immediately visible from the ground.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for an asphalt roof inspection ranges from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more intricate roofs may cost more, sometimes exceeding $400.

Service Fees - Many local pros charge a flat fee for comprehensive asphalt roof inspections, usually between $100 and $250. Additional inspections or detailed reports can increase the overall cost.

Additional Expenses - If repairs or maintenance are recommended, costs can vary widely, with minor fixes starting around $200 and more extensive repairs reaching $1,000 or more. Inspection costs are separate from repair expenses.

Cost Factors - Factors influencing inspection costs include roof height, accessibility, and the extent of visual or detailed assessments needed. Contact local pros to get tailored estimates for asphalt roof inspections in Mechanicsville, MD, and surrounding are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why should I have my asphalt roof inspected? Regular inspections can help identify early signs of damage or wear, potentially preventing costly repairs in the future.

How often should an asphalt roof be inspected? It is recommended to have an asphalt ro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events.

What are common issues found during asphalt roof inspections? Common issues include cracked or missing shingles, damaged flashing, and signs of water infiltration or mold.

Can a roof inspection help extend the lifespan of my asphalt roof? Yes, timely identification of problems can lead to repairs that help prolong the roof’s durability and performance.
